Ingredients Jump to Instructions ↓

  1. 3/4 cup butter , softened

  2. 1/2 cup confectioners' sugar

  3. 1 1/2 cups flour

  4. 1 (10 ounce) package white chocolate chips or 1 (10 ounce) package vanilla chips

  5. 1/4 cup whipping cream

  6. 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ese , softened

  7. raspberries

  8. kiwi

  9. peach (etc.)

Instructions Jump to Ingredients ↑

  1. Heat oven to 300°F.

  2. Beat butter and sugar until light and fluffy.

  3. Blend in flour.

  4. Press the mixture onto the bottom and up the side of a 12 inch round pizza pan.

  5.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until just lightly brown.

  6. Cool completely.

  7. Carefully melt the vanilla or white chocolate chips and the cream either carefully on the stove on very low, stirring constantly, or in the microwave.

  8. Beat in the cream cheese.

  9. When crust is cool, pour on the melted chocolate/cheese mixture, spreading evenly.

  10. Cover with plastic wrap and chill until ready to serve--at least 3 hours.

  11. Slice the fruit of your choice and place on the tart in an attractive manner.

  12. This is best eaten the same day it's made.
